Meaning
Laboratory filtration refers to the process of separating solids or particulate matter from a liquid or gas sample in a laboratory setting. It involves the use of various filtration methods and devices, such as filter papers, membranes, syringe filters, and filter units. Laboratory filtration is critical for sample preparation, purification, sterilization, and analysis across diverse scientific disciplines, including pharmaceuticals, biotechnology, food and beverage, environmental testing, and research.

Category-wise Insights
- Filter Papers: Filter papers are widely used in laboratory filtration for general filtration purposes, such as clarifying liquids, separating solids, and collecting precipitates. These porous papers effectively trap particulate matter, ensuring the purity of samples.
- Membranes: Membrane filters are used for precise filtration and separation of particles based on size and molecular weight. These thin films with microscopic pores offer high flow rates and excellent particle retention, making them suitable for various laboratory applications.
- Filtration Systems: Filtration systems, including vacuum filtration systems and pressure filtration systems, provide efficient and automated filtration processes. These systems enable larger sample volumes to be processed, enhance filtration efficiency, and improve workflow in laboratories.
- Syringe Filters: Syringe filters are compact and disposable filtration devices used for sample preparation and clarification. These filters are available in various sizes and pore sizes, enabling precise filtration and preventing contamination.

Covid-19 Impact
The COVID-19 pandemic had a significant impact on the laboratory filtration market. The increased need for testing and research related to the virus led to a surge in demand for laboratory filtration products, particularly in molecular biology laboratories, diagnostic laboratories, and research institutions. Filtration played a crucial role in sample preparation, purification, and virus particle removal during testing and research processes.
Moreover, the pandemic emphasized the importance of laboratory safety, contamination control, and reliable filtration solutions to prevent the spread of infectious diseases. Laboratories worldwide prioritized the use of high-quality filtration products to ensure the accuracy and integrity of testing and research results.
